Square Octavo (8 1/8 inches; 205 mm), 219, [1] pages in publisher's original blue cloth, titles in silver to spine, in a photo-illustrated dust jacket.

SIGNED by many of the contributors to this important (and now classic) anthology of New York School poets, featuring works by nine poets and illustrations by an equal number of artists. Signed on the table of contents page by: Frank Lima, Red Grooms, Norman Bluhm, Joe Brainard, Alex Katz, John Bernard Myers, Alan D'Archangelo, Tony Towle, Barbara Guest, Kenneth Koch, John Ashbery, Robert Goodnough, and Kenward Elmslie.

Interesting, lengthy introduction by John Bernard Myers, who championed many poets of the 1950s and published early works by Frank O'Hara, John Ashbery, Kenneth Koch, and others, either in separate editions or through his poetry journal Semi-Colon.

Unsigned copies of this book are easily obtainable, but copies signed by so many of the contributors are not often seen in the market. A beautiful copy of this landmark anthology, signed by numerous important poets and artists. SCARCE SIGNED.

CONDITION: A bit of soiling to the top edge, boards slightly splayed. Otherwise, Fine in a dust jacket with light sunning to the upper panel and spine and some rubbing.
